JPST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

1,075 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Ultra-Short Income ETF (JPST)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$21.2B — up 12% from $18.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 174 funds opened new JPST positions and 59 closed out — a net gain of 115 holders — while 476 added to existing stakes and 345 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$1.21B. The largest seller was Charles Schwab, cutting an estimated $132M.
